The HVUT, or Heavy Vehicle Use Tax, is a once a year tax paid by truck drivers or owners of trucking companies. It is applicable to drivers operating large vehicles on our nation's highway, and ranks money goes towards maintaining roads, alleviating congestion, keeping the roads safe, and funding new projects.

U.S. citizens are likely to shell out taxes on all incomes made in foreign areas. The proceeds are to be included his or her income tax returns and needed taxes must be paid. However, for incomes that are taxed in the foreign countries, taxpayers should include a tax credit equivalent for the taxes paid but towards the limit on the taxes yard have been paid if your taxable income was made domestically. For citizens that reside abroad, the IRS provides a tax free waiver for your first $92,900 earned next year.

Clients in order to be aware that different rules apply when the IRS has recently placed a tax lien against all. A bankruptcy may relieve you of personal liability on the tax debt, but in some circumstances will not discharge a correctly filed tax lien. After bankruptcy, the irs cannot chase you personally for the debt, however the lien stay in on any assets so you will stop being able to market these assets without satisfying the outstanding lien. - this includes your homes. Depending upon the lien any time filed, might be be other new to attack the validity of the lien.
